Extract the .tgz file and cd
into the root directory CoCoALib-NNN
:
tar xzf CoCoALib-NNN.tgz cd CoCoALib-NNN
Then configure and compile. In most cases the following two commands will suffice:
./configure --only-cocoalib make
The command make
compiles CoCoALib (and puts it in lib/libcocoa.a
);
it also compiles & runs the test suite, and compiles the example programs.
Good news: all CoCoALib tests passed

(1) The configure script looks for the GMP library, and makes a few checks.
It assumes your compiler is g++
. If it encounters a problem, it will
print out a helpful error message telling you.
(2) The command make library
will compile the library but not run the tests.
The command make check
will run the tests -- they are in src/tests/
.
CoCoALib does not yet have an official make install
target.
(3) For the adventurous: the command
./configure --help
explains the various options the script recognizes.
(4) Optimization for small polynomials (not really recommended)
By default CoCoALib
allows quite polynomials of quite high degree
(e.g. typically beyond 1000000). If you are sure that degrees will
remain small (e.g. below 1000) then you might obtain better performance
by editing the source file include/CoCoA/config.H
so that the typedef
for SmallExponent_t
is unsigned short
instead of unsigned int
.
But beware that CoCoALib does not generally check for exponent overflow
during polynomial arithmetic!

Recent MacOSX systems use the "llvm" compiler which produces
numerous warnings with the BOOST libraries; please ignore these
warnings. If you know how to edit makefiles, you can add the
flag -Wno-c99-extensions
to the definition of CXXFLAGS_CUSTOM
on line 3 of src/CoCoA-5/Makefile
-- this should get rid of
most of the warnings.
You can build CoCoALib
and CoCoA-5
on a Microsoft Windows
computer by using Cygwin
, a free package which provides a
Linux-like environment (see http://www.cygwin.com/
).
Once you have installed Cygwin
, start its terminal emulator,
and then follow the usual instructions above for compiling CoCoALib
.
